What does a LaRosa Chicken and Grill Franchise Cost?
LaRosa Chicken and Grill franchise fees for 2022:
Cash Investment: $150,000
Total Investment: $473,800-732,500
Minimum Net Worth: $500,000
Franchise Fee: $35,000
Royalty: 5%
Ad: up to 2%
Average Number of Employees: 8-15
Item 19: Yes (AUV more than $1.1m)
Visa Candidates: Yes (owner speaks fluent Spanish and Itallian, VP
is of Indian descent)
Passive Ownership: Yes
Home Based: No
B2B: No
Master Franchise Opportunities: Yes
Veteran Discount: No
Is LaRosa Chicken and Grill a Semi Absentee Franchise with a Passive Ownership Opportunity?
Yes. LaRosa Chicken and Grill is a semi absentee franchise and allows passive ownership. A semi-absentee franchise is a business you could start and run while still maintaining a job or other obligation.

Is LaRosa Chicken and Grill a Master Franchise Opportunity?
Yes. LaRosa Chicken and Grill is a master franchise opportunity. A master franchisee is responsible to recruit, train and support franchisees in their territory.
